Frequently Asked Questions about Young Terrace

How much are Studio apartments in Young Terrace?

There are currently 33 Studio Apartments in Young Terrace with rent ranges from $900 to $2,344 with an average price of $1,443.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Young Terrace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Young Terrace ranges from $656 to $2,886 with an average monthly rent of $1,600.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Young Terrace c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Young Terrace range from $995 to $3,282.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,998.

How expensive are Young Terrace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 56 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Young Terrace on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$895 to $4,860 - averaging $2,510 for the location.
